143144145146147148149150151152153
writer.element("select"); select.options(writer); writer.end(); assertEquals(writer.toString(), read("blank_label.txt")); verify(); }
176177178179180181182183184185186
writer.element("select"); select.options(writer); writer.end(); // fred will be selected, not barney, because the validation tracker // takes precendence. assertEquals(writer.toString(), read("current_selection_from_validation_tracker.txt"));
220221222223224225226227228229230
writer.element("select"); select.options(writer); writer.end(); assertEquals(writer.toString(), read("option_attributes.txt")); verify(); }
267268269270271272273274275276277
writer.element("select"); select.options(writer); writer.end(); assertEquals(writer.toString(), read("disabled_option.txt")); verify(); }
302303304305306307308309310311312
writer.element("select"); select.options(writer); writer.end(); assertEquals(writer.toString(), read("option_groups.txt")); verify(); }
335336337338339340341342343344345
writer.element("select"); select.options(writer); writer.end(); assertEquals(writer.toString(), read("option_groups_precede_ungroup_options.txt")); verify(); }
370371372373374375376377378379380
writer.element("select"); select.options(writer); writer.end(); assertEquals(writer.toString(), read("option_group_attributes.txt")); verify(); }
4546474849505152535455
component.injectValue("Fred\nBarney\rWilma\r\nBetty\nBam-Bam\n"); writer.element("div"); component.beginRender(writer); writer.end(); assertEquals(writer.toString(), "<?xml version=\"1.0\"?>\n" + "<div><p>Fred</p><p>Barney</p><p>Wilma</p><p>Betty</p><p>Bam-Bam</p></div>"); } }
5758596061626364656667
verify(); Element e = writer.getElement(); writer.write("link text"); writer.end(); assertEquals(writer.toString(), "<a href=\"/foo/bar.baz\">link text</a>"); assertSame(map.get(e), invocation); }
8990919293949596979899
verify(); Element e = writer.getElement(); writer.write("link text"); writer.end(); assertEquals(writer.toString(), "<a href=\"/foo/bar.baz#wilma\">link text</a>"); assertSame(map.get(e), invocation); } }